“Daddy’s Not The One” is part of the debut EP by American singer-songwriter KELS. Born in Germany and raised in Pittsburgh, the artist currently resides in Atlanta, where she develops a sound that fuses jazz, pop, and neo-soul with a raw blues reminiscent of Amy Winehouse.

In 2023, she embarked on a 52-concert independent tour across the United States, without the backing of a manager or record label, successfully capturing the public's attention and generating growing anticipation for her project.

“Daddy’s Not The One” is a powerful single that portrays the consequences of getting involved with someone who promises a lot but delivers little. Through this song, KELS champions female independence and argues that it’s preferable to be alone than to depend on false “providers” whose promises ultimately crumble.

The music video takes place at a campsite, where KELS shares the screen with two women and delivers a sensual performance. Filmed in a single, uninterrupted take, the video embraces a natural aesthetic that reinforces the honesty and rawness conveyed by the song.
